The compressed release cycle signals a shift where multiple labs compete in parallel, with capability gaps narrowing and ecosystem integration becoming as important as raw intelligence.", "body_md": "Between July 1 and July 16, 2026, the frontier AI landscape compressed months of progress into just over two weeks.\n\nFive major models launched, returned to service, or entered broad availability:\n\nThis wasn't just a busy release cycle.\n\nIt felt like a preview of the next phase of AI competition—one where multiple labs move almost simultaneously, capability gaps narrow rapidly, and ecosystems matter just as much as raw intelligence.\n\nFor developers, founders, and technical leaders, the biggest risk isn't falling behind on model releases. It's letting the constant stream of announcements distract you from actually building.\n\nThe sequence was remarkable:\n\n| Date | Event |\n|---|---|\n| July 1 | Claude Fable 5 returns globally after suspension |\n| July 8 | Grok 4.5 launches |\n| July 9 | GPT-5.6 Sol enters general availability |\n| July 9 | Meta releases Muse Spark 1.1 |\n| July 16 | Moonshot AI launches Kimi K3 |\n\nWhat makes this unusual isn't just the number of releases.\n\nIt's that they came from different major AI labs, all claiming **frontier-level** capabilities.\n\nAccording to Artificial Analysis, four frontier-class models launched within roughly eight days, while six separate labs now field models above 50 on the Intelligence Index—a dramatic increase from only a handful of leaders just months earlier.\n\nThe frontier is no longer a single company pulling ahead.\n\nIt's multiple companies moving in parallel.\n\nHistorically, one lab would release a breakthrough model and enjoy months of clear leadership before competitors caught up.\n\nThat dynamic is fading.\n\n**Claude Fable 5** established itself as one of the strongest frontier models when it launched in June. Yet within weeks, **GPT-5.6 Sol**, **Grok 4.5**, **Muse Spark 1.1**, and **Kimi K3** all entered the conversation.\n\nThe result is a frontier where capability differences are increasingly measured in percentages rather than generations.\n\nFor developers and businesses, that changes how decisions get made.\n\nWhen quality differences become smaller, factors like cost, latency, reliability, context length, and workflow integration become far more important.\n\nClaude Fable 5 may be remembered as much for its regulatory journey as for its technical capabilities.\n\nFollowing concerns related to
